Milwaukee Brewers @ California Angels

1986-05-10 Β· Night game Β· Angel Stadium of Anaheim Β· Att: 35371 Β· 2:40

Milwaukee Brewers defeated California Angels 4–2. Milwaukee Brewers put up 2 in the 6th. Juan Nieves earned the win and Dan Plesac picked up the save.
